Attractions

When you think about New York City, you think about so many different places to go visit and explore that you better plan ahead and make sure you have enough time to cover it all. You might want to start by walking down Central Park, which is a great place to visit especially if you are planning a family trip, so that your children can plan, run and enjoy their time in the Big Apple. You can then drive close to Madison Square Garden and even attend one of the many daily events and shows performed there. For example, if your children have a favorite singer who is schedule to
perform there, this could be the perfect opportunity for you to surprise them with a live concert of their idol.

New York Time Square

Alternatively, if you are into sightseeing, you cannot absolutely miss Times Square, where you can make sure to take lots of pictures and maybe you will be able to meet somebody famous who just happens to walk by. Moreover, you can go visit the Statue of Liberty and take a boat ride that makes you go very close to it so you can admire if from the sea. Also, don’t forget to pay homage to the Empire State Building, and if you really want a thrilling experience, get on the very last floor and admire New York City from the best point of view there is.

More Attractions and Restaurants

New York City is a melting pot of societies, so you will have no problems finding a place to eat that tickles your taste buds. If you want to eat Italian, for example, you can drive to Little Italy and taste the real Italian food cooked for you by Italian immigrants who have been running real Italian food restaurants for generations.
